A shocking incident made the headlines recently, where a man from Shamli, Uttar Pradesh, killed his wife when he learned that she had gone to her parents’ home without wearing a burqa. Equally appalling was that he denied her Aadhaar card because he didn’t want her picture on it.

Farooq, the husband and the accused in the case, worked as a cook at weddings. He was enraged when he came to know that his wife had been to her parents’ home without wearing a burqa. He killed her for not wearing a burqa. Even when she was alive, he didn’t let her apply for an Aadhaar Card because he didn’t want her photo to be seen, said the police. The man had also killed his two daughters. Farooq had been adamant that his wife, Tahira, 32, should always wear a burqa. And, for 18 years, he did not allow her to make any identity document like Aadhaar and ration card, as it would then have her photo without the burqa. Police said that the couple have five children Afreen, 14; Asmeen, 10; Sehreen, 7; Bilal, 9, and Arshad, 5. After killing his wife, he shot Afreen and strangled Sehreen, the police said.
More on the atrocious murder of Tahira by her husband.
The weapon that Farooq used to kill Tahira has been recovered based on his confession. They include a pistol, seven empty shells and 10 live cartridges. Farooq would also not allow his father-in-law to meet his wife whenever they came home. The murder was discovered after Tahira and her two daughters were not seen for six days. His father, Dawood, repeatedly asked him about his wife and daughters, but he evaded the question. He told his father he kept them in a rented house in Shamli. Dawood informed the police on Tuesday that he suspected his son had committed homicide. The accused was arrested and interrogated, the police said. It was then that he admitted to the murders.
A month ago, Tahira went to her parents’ house without wearing the burqa, which Farooq said ruined his reputation. Angered by this, he shot Tahira in the kitchen at midnight on December 10. His eldest daughter, Afreen, woke up hearing the gunshot. When she came to the kitchen, he shot her as well. When his second daughter, Sehreen, came to see what happened, he strangled her. Farooq buried their bodies in a nine-foot-deep pit dug for a toilet in the courtyard and laid a brick floor over it.
